**Welcome, Plugin Authors!**

The Mapling address autocomplete widget is the heart of the Veloro checkout flow, and your plugins hook into its suggestion pipeline. Keep handlers under 50ms or the widget falls back to plain text entry — nobody wants that. Use the sandbox tenant for testing; it resets nightly. One quirk: the sandbox credential store occasionally locks itself after a reset. No need to file a ticket when that happens — just unlock it with the recovery passphrase below.

vault phrase of bagaf-kajeg = jorath-feniel-briir-siliel-ralix

Key Ceremony Checklist — Item 7

Before signing the Snapcrate 3.2 hotfix build, confirm the image-cache memory leak fix (unbounded thumbnail retention in the decode pool) is merged and verified under the 12-hour soak test. Do not proceed if RSS growth exceeds 2% per hour. Two custodians present, witness log signed, HSM unsealed. After the signing key is loaded, re-seal the module and record the rotation in the ceremony ledger. The recovery passphrase for the backup key shard is as follows.

vault phrase of taweg-kafof = oliax-zorael

# Env file — Cartwheel dispatch, driver-assignment heuristic
# Scope: staging only. Do not promote to prod.
# The heuristic weights (proximity, shift balance, refusal rate) are tuned
# for the Velmont pilot region and will misbehave elsewhere.
# Review notes: heuristic service runs unprivileged; it reads weights
# read-only from the tuning store and writes nothing back.
# Only one sensitive value exists in this file: the tuning-store access
# credential, consumed at boot and never logged.
# That credential is set on the following line.

secret setting of faduf-bahop: LEDGER_TOKEN8=c3b363be